castle in the air in German is Luftschloss, Traumschloss.
castle in the air in German
Luftschloss
(idiomatic) A desire, idea, or plan that is unlikely to ever be realized; a visionary project or scheme; a daydream, an idle fancy, a near impossibility. [from mid 16th c.]
